1. Conduct Deep User Research to Tailor Onboarding Experiences
Successful onboarding starts with understanding the diverse enterprise user base and their unique needs. UX designers use qualitative and quantitative methods to discover user roles, goals, pain points, and technical proficiency levels.
Effective Research Methods
- User Interviews & Surveys: Gather insights from end-users, admins, and IT staff to identify challenges and expectations.
- Contextual Inquiry: Observe users in their work environments to understand real-world software interactions.
- Data Analytics: Analyze user behavior data and onboarding drop-off points using tools like Mixpanel or Pendo.
- Persona Development: Create representative personas that reflect different enterprise user segments.
Result
Targeted onboarding material aligned to user needs shortens learning curves and skips irrelevant content, significantly reducing training time.
2. Simplify Complexity with Strategic Information Architecture and Navigation Design
Enterprise software interfaces often overwhelm with extensive features. UX designers simplify this complexity by designing intuitive navigation and clear information architecture (IA).
Proven Strategies
- Progressive Disclosure: Introduce core functionality first, deferring advanced features to later stages.
- Task-Centered Navigation: Structure menus around key user workflows (e.g., data reporting, administration), enhancing discoverability.
- Clear Taxonomies: Use industry-standard terminology to reduce confusion.
- Personalizable Dashboards: Enable users to configure interfaces and shortcuts for faster access.
Benefit
A clear, user-friendly IA decreases cognitive load, allowing users to quickly find what they need and accelerating onboarding.
3. Build Interactive, Contextual Onboarding Features within the Application
Replacing manual-heavy training with in-app, interactive onboarding is essential for reducing time-to-proficiency in complex systems.
Key Interactive Elements
- Step-by-Step Guides: Use tooltip-driven walkthroughs and modals to explain features contextually.
- Microlearning Modules: Integrate concise tutorials triggered during natural workflows.
- Interactive Checklists: Help users track onboarding progress and critical setup tasks.
- In-App Messaging: Deliver timely tips and prompts to reinforce learning.

Outcome
Contextual, just-in-time learning increases engagement, improves retention, and reduces reliance on lengthy instructor-led sessions.
4. Employ Behavioral Design to Motivate Adoption and Habit Formation
UX designers integrate behavioral psychology principles to nudge users towards active engagement and software adoption.
Behavioral Design Techniques
- Progress Indicators: Visual feedback on onboarding milestones boosts motivation.
- Gamification: Incorporate badges, points, or rewards to recognize accomplishments.
- Social Proof: Highlight endorsements, peer usage, and success stories.
- Default Settings: Offer pre-configured options to reduce decision fatigue.
- Error Mitigation: Design forgiving interfaces with helpful error recovery.
Impact
Behavior-driven onboarding shifts the experience from obligatory to engaging, increasing long-term adoption rates.
5. Implement Adaptive, Role-Based Onboarding for Diverse Enterprise User Profiles
Enterprise clients have various user roles with different knowledge requirements. Adaptive onboarding ensures each role receives tailored guidance.
Role-Specific Onboarding Tactics
- Custom Flows per Role: Create distinct onboarding paths for executives, analysts, IT admins, etc.
- Skill Assessments: Use quizzes or tasks to gauge proficiency and adjust onboarding complexity.
- Localization: Provide multi-language support and cultural considerations for global teams.
- Dynamic Content Delivery: Modify tutorials and help content based on user behavior and progress.
Advantage
Role-based adaptive onboarding minimizes irrelevant training, enhances user confidence faster, and cuts training duration.

7. Leverage Data Analytics and Continuous Iteration to Optimize Onboarding
Data-driven UX design ensures onboarding evolves with user needs and business goals.
Key Metrics to Monitor
- Onboarding completion and dropout rates.
- User engagement patterns via heatmaps and click analytics.
- Support tickets related to onboarding challenges.
- User satisfaction measured through in-app surveys.
Optimization Techniques
- A/B Testing: Experiment with onboarding variants to identify best performers.
- Session Replay: Observe actual user onboarding journeys to uncover pain points.
- Agile Iteration: Rapidly deploy updates using prototyping tools like Figma or Adobe XD.
Result
Continuous refinement shortens training timelines and boosts enterprise-wide adoption rates.
